推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
在Linux操作系统中,通过VPS搭建SSH服务器,能够轻松实现远程管理和保障数据安全。通过简单的步骤,用户即可配置SSH服务,有效提高系统访问的安全性,确保数据传输的私密性。这一过程不仅便于远程操作,还大大增强了网络安全防护。
本文目录导读:
在当今的互联网时代,远程管理与数据安全变得越来越重要,SSH(Secure Shell)服务器作为一种安全的网络协议,可以有效地实现远程登录、文件传输等功能,本文将为您详细介绍如何在VPS(Virtual Private Server)上搭建SSH服务器,让您轻松实现远程管理与数据安全。
VPS简介
VPS,即虚拟私有服务器,是一种基于虚拟化技术的服务,它将物理服务器分割成多个虚拟服务器,每个虚拟服务器都拥有独立的操作系统、资源分配和IP地址,VPS具有以下优点:
1、价格相对实惠:相较于物理服务器,VPS的价格更为亲民,适合个人和企业用户。
2、灵活配置:用户可以根据需求自由配置CPU、内存、硬盘等资源。
3、独立性强:每个VPS都拥有独立的操作系统和IP地址,互不干扰。
SSH服务器简介
SSH服务器是一种网络协议,用于实现计算机之间的加密登录和其他安全网络服务,SSH协议具有以下特点:
1、安全性:SSH协议使用公钥加密技术,确保数据传输的安全性。
2、可靠性:SSH协议具有良好的网络适应性,能够在不稳定网络环境下保持连接。
3、功能强大:SSH服务器支持远程登录、文件传输、端口映射等多种功能。
VPS搭建SSH服务器的步骤
1、选择合适的VPS提供商
您需要选择一家可靠的VPS提供商,在选择时,要考虑以下因素:
- 价格:根据您的预算选择合适的套餐。
- 性能:确保VPS提供商拥有稳定的网络环境和足够的资源。
- 服务:选择提供24小时在线客服的提供商,以便在遇到问题时能够及时解决。
2、购买VPS并配置操作系统
购买VPS后,您需要配置操作系统,常见的操作系统有CentOS、Ubuntu、Debian等,以下以CentOS为例进行说明:
- 登录VPS提供商的控制面板,选择“创建VPS”。
- 选择合适的操作系统版本(如CentOS 7)。
- 分配CPU、内存、硬盘等资源。
- 设置VPS的IP地址和密码。
3、安装SSH服务器
在操作系统配置完成后,您可以开始安装SSH服务器,以下以OpenSSH为例进行说明:
- 使用SSH客户端连接到VPS(如使用PuTTY)。
- 输入以下命令安装OpenSSH:yum install openssh-server -y
(CentOS系统)或apt-get install openssh-server -y
(Ubuntu/Debian系统)。
- 启动SSH服务:systemctl start sshd
(CentOS系统)或service ssh start
(Ubuntu/Debian系统)。
4、配置SSH服务器
为了提高安全性,您需要对SSH服务器进行一些配置:
- 修改SSH端口:编辑/etc/ssh/sshd_config
文件,将Port
参数修改为其他端口(如2222)。
- 禁止root用户登录:在/etc/ssh/sshd_config
文件中添加PerMitRootLogin no
。
- 重启SSH服务:systemctl restart sshd
(CentOS系统)或service ssh restart
(Ubuntu/Debian系统)。
5、设置防火墙规则
为了确保SSH服务器的安全,您需要设置防火墙规则,允许SSH端口(如2222)的连接:
- 编辑防火墙配置文件:vi /etc/sysconfig/iptables
(CentOS系统)或vi /etc/default/ufw
(Ubuntu系统)。
- 添加以下规则:-A INPUT -p tcp -m state --state NEW -m tcp --dport 2222 -j ACCEPT
。
- 重启防火墙:systemctl restart iptables
(CentOS系统)或ufw enable
(Ubuntu系统)。
通过以上步骤,您已经成功在VPS上搭建了SSH服务器,您可以使用SSH客户端安全地连接到VPS,进行远程管理与数据传输,在搭建过程中,请注意以下几点:
1、定期更新操作系统和SSH服务器,确保安全。
2、不要使用默认端口,以降低被攻击的风险。
3、设置复杂的密码,并定期更改。
以下是50个中文相关关键词:
VPS, 搭建, SSH服务器, 远程管理, 数据安全, 虚拟私有服务器, 虚拟化技术, 物理服务器, 价格, 性价比, 灵活配置, 独立操作系统, 独立IP地址, 网络协议, 加密登录, 安全性, 可靠性, 功能, 网络环境, 资源, 服务商, 客服, 操作系统, CentOS, Ubuntu, Debian, OpenSSH, SSH客户端, PuTTY, 命令, 启动服务, 配置文件, 安全配置, 防火墙规则, 端口, 防护, 攻击, 密码, 更新, 复杂, 风险, 连接, 管理员, 文件传输, 端口映射, 网络适应性, 状态, 接受, 规则, 重启, 防火墙, 启用
本文标签属性:
VPS搭建SSH服务器:vps搭建教程ss 最便宜的